In this review of Terra Bamboo Water Baby Wipes the bottom line is simple: these are a strong, minimal-ingredient wipe for parents who prioritize pure ingredients and biodegradability. The wipes use 99.7% pure New Zealand purified water plus a small amount of hydrolyzed soy protein, so they feel like water with substance rather than a chemical lotion. They are made from 100% FSC certified bamboo fiber (not bamboo viscose) and are designed to be thick, textured and gentle - a solid choice for sensitive skin and everyday messes.
Key Features
- Pure liquid base: The formula is 99.7% purified New Zealand water, which minimizes irritants while still cleansing effectively.
- Natural cloth material: Cloth is made from 100% FSC certified bamboo fiber for a soft, cloth-like texture that is durable for wiping.
- Free from harsh additives: No fragrances, optical brighteners, plastic or unnecessary chemicals, reducing the risk of irritation on delicate skin.
- Dermatologically tested: Rated Excellent for all skin types by Dermatest, making it suitable for babies with sensitive skin.
- Thick and textured: Cross-woven construction and extra moisture provide a durable wipe that cleans without tearing easily under normal use.
- Made in New Zealand: Manufacture in New Zealand with transparent ingredient information for purchasers who want origin details.
Who It's For
These wipes are aimed at parents and caregivers looking for a simple, low-ingredient option for bums, faces and hands, especially where sensitivity or fragrance reactions are a concern. They suit everyday diaper changes, quick clean-ups and use with a wipe warmer because the formula is mostly water and unscented.
Those who need truly flushable wipes should look elsewhere, and buyers expecting a completely snag-proof cover or an ultra-thin economical sheet may prefer other styles; some customers have noted occasional issues with snag resistance and lid covers coming loose.

Frequently Asked Questions
Are these wipes safe for newborn skin?
Yes; they are dermatologically tested and formulated with 99.7% purified water and no fragrances, making them suitable for sensitive and newborn skin.
Are Terra wipes flushable?
No; like most baby wipes these are not flushable even though the cloth is 100% biodegradable and should be disposed of with waste or composted where local rules allow.
Do they contain plastic or harsh chemicals?
No; the wipes contain 0% plastic, no optical brighteners, no fragrances and no other harsh ingredients according to the product information.
